Reused sulfur removal particulate filtering device of EGR system of diesel engine

2015 
The invention belongs to the technical field of a purification device in an diesel engine and environmental protection and particularly relates to a reused sulfur removal particulate filtering device of an EGR (exhaust gas re-circulation) system of the diesel engine. The filtering device comprises a particulate filtering chamber, an isolation layer, and a sulfur removal chamber; the particulate filtering chamber comprises a gas inlet end and an installing end A; the sulfur removal chamber comprises a gas outlet end and an installing end B, wherein the installing end A and the installing end B are in an unenclosed structure and fixed on the isolation layer, and the isolation layer is in an dense net-shaped structure; a particulate filtering cartridge is installed in the particulate filtering chamber and a sulfur removal filtering cartridge is installed in the sulfur removal chamber; the gas inlet end is connected with the gas outlet end of an EGR cooler, and the gas outlet end is connected with an EGR valve. The filtering device is used for filtering particulate matters and SO2 in the EGR system of the diesel engine, so that the particulates in waste gas cannot again enter a burning chamber and the particulate matter emission of the diesel engine is reduced; the filtering device can avoid the phenomenon that the quantity of exhaust gas entering into a cylinder cannot be controlled so that the particle emission of the diesel engine is increased when the EGR valve is out of work due to long-term sulfur corrosion.
